H_2O_2对Apg-2与BCR/ABL蛋白亚细胞定位的影响

摘    要:目的观察H2O2对Apg-2与BCR/ABL蛋白亚细胞定位的影响。方法用50μmol/L H2O2分别处理BaF3-BCR/ABL、BaF3-MIGR1及过表达Apg-2蛋白的BaF3-BCR/ABL细胞,激光共聚焦显微镜观察细胞内Apg-2、BCR/ABL蛋白的亚细胞定位变化。结果 Apg-2和BCR/ABL蛋白在细胞中定位于胞浆,H2O2损伤可致Apg-2和BCR/ABL蛋白在BaF3-BCR/ABL细胞中发生核转位,Apg-2蛋白过表达可引起BCR/ABL蛋白核转位。结论 Apg-2蛋白在H2O2诱导的损伤后发生核转位,可能与BCR/ABL蛋白相互作用,保护H2O2诱导的细胞损伤。

Effect of H2O2 on subcellular localization of Apg-2 and BCR/ABL proteins
Abstract:Objective To observe the effect of H2O2 on subcellular localization of Apg-2 and BCR / ABL proteins.Methods BaF3-BCR / ABL and BaF3-MIGR1 cells as well as BaF3-BCR / ABL cells in which Apg-2 was overexpressed were treated with 50 μmol / L H2O2 respectively,and determined for subcellular localization of Apg-2 and BCR / ABL proteins by confocal microscopy.Results Both Apg-2 and BCR / ABL proteins were located in cytoplasm.However,H2O2 treatment caused the translocation of Apg-2 and BCR / ABL proteins,while the overexpression of Apg-2 caused the translocation of BCR / ABL,into nucleus of BaF3-BCR / ABL cells.Conclusion H2O2 induced-damage contributed to nuclear translocation of Apg-2 which might interact with BCR / ABL to protect cells from the damage.
